Hershey's Kisses

Last minute shoppers who have a gluten-free sweetheart are in luck – everyone loves a kiss and most of us love a chocolate kiss. In a pinch you can find HERSHEY’S KISSES® at most grocery stores, wholesale clubs, dollar stores, drug stores, and convenience stores.

 

The following flavors are gluten-free:

HERSHEY’S MINI KISSES Brand Milk Chocolates

HERSHEY’S KISSES Milk Chocolates

HERSHEY’S KISSES Milk Chocolates with Almonds

HERSHEY’S KISSES Milk Chocolates filled with Caramel

HERSHEY’S KISSES Milk Chocolates filled with Cherry Cordial Creme

HERSHEY’S KISSES Milk Chocolates filled with Coconut Creme

HERSHEY’S KISSES Milk Chocolates filled with Mint Truffle

HERSHEY’S KISSES SPECIAL DARK Mildly Sweet Chocolates
